What is the first step to take before inspecting steering lash on a vehicle?

Explanation:
Before inspecting steering lash on a vehicle, placing the vehicle on a smooth, dry, level surface is crucial for several reasons. This ensures stability during the inspection, preventing any unintended movements that could lead to inaccurate readings or safety hazards. A level surface allows the technician to accurately assess the play in the steering mechanism without the interference of sloping ground, which could affect the alignment and behavior of the steering components. This foundational step aligns with industry best practices, ensuring that the inspection is thorough and reliable. Establishing a proper environment by using a smooth and level surface is fundamental to conducting a safe and effective inspection, as it sets the stage for evaluating the steering system accurately.

The Play in Steering Mechanisms

Now, let’s talk about steering lash. That’s the back-and-forth play in the steering wheel that’s crucial to assess. If you’re trying to inspect this while the vehicle is positioned awkwardly, you’re likely to get inaccurate readings. In the world of automotive checks, precision is key! A level surface allows for a clear evaluation of how much play exists in the steering mechanism, without any interference from the ground beneath.
